Legislative Research: NY S04316 | 2023-2024 | General Assembly
Other Sessions
Session | Title/Description | Last Action |
---|---|---|
2023-2024 General Assembly (Introduced) | Establishes a claim for strict liability against the state for any injury caused by the administration of an immunization which is mandated by a state law; gives the court of claims the power and jurisdiction to hear such a claim. [S04316 2023 Detail][S04316 2023 Text][S04316 2023 Comments] | 2024-01-03 REFERRED TO HEALTH |
